  • Patent number: 11631148
    Abstract: The present disclosure describes smart meter modules. A smart meter module may include a support frame and an outer cover. The support frame includes a top mounting plate, a bottom mounting plate, and an inner bracket between the top and bottom mounting plates and coupled thereto. The top mounting plate is spaced apart a distance from the bottom mounting plate to form an interior space of the module. The inner bracket has a central aperture that is generally perpendicular relative to the top and bottom mounting plates and configured to receive and secure a smart meter within the interior space of the module. The outer cover is configured to be secured to the inner bracket and sized to extend circumferentially around the interior space of the module. One or more elongated mounting apertures in the bottom mounting plate are configured such that the smart meter module can be secured to the top of a mounting pole. Smart meter module assemblies are also provided.

  • Patent number: 11316244
    Abstract: An adjustable mount for an antenna includes: a generally vertical pole; a plurality of rails mounted adjacent the pole's upper end, each of the rails including a cap with a mounting hole at its upper end; a mounting foundation having a base panel and a mounting platform positioned above the base panel, the base panel including a set of discontinuous slots extending at an oblique angle to a radius originating at a center point of the base panel; a plurality of threaded members inserted into the mounting hole of a respective one of the rails and one of the set of discontinuous slots to mount the mounting foundation above the upper end of the pole; and a plurality of nuts threaded onto a respective threaded member beneath the base panel. Rotation of the nut relative to the threaded member causes an overlying section of the base panel to move vertically.

  • Publication number: 20210410318
    Abstract: An electronics enclosure includes: a housing having a floor, a ceiling, a rear wall, a pair of side walls, and a door mounted to one of the side walls that define an internal cavity; a first generally vertically-disposed mounting blade; first electronic equipment mounted on the first mounting blade; and a first sliding mechanism mounted to the housing and to the first mounting blade, the sliding mechanism configured to permit the first mounting blade and the first electronic equipment to move between a retracted position, in which the first mounting blade is positioned in the internal cavity, and an extended position, in which the first mounting blade is positioned forwardly of the internal cavity to facilitate access to the first electronic equipment.
